Dean Phillips Considers \u2064Third-Party Presidential Bid<\/h2>\n<p>Rep. Dean Phillips (D-MN), a\u200c Democratic presidential candidate, has expressed his willingness to\u2062 entertain \u2062a third<a href=\"https:\/\/www.conservativenewsdaily.net\/breaking-news\/signs-hint-that-joe-manchin-could-be-preparing-for-potential-third-party-presidential-bid-report\/\" title=\"Joe Manchin may be considering a third-party presidential bid, according to reports.\">-party presidential bid<\/a> if it seems likely that President Joe Biden would lose \u2063a rematch against former President Donald Trump.<\/p>\n<p>Phillips \u200chas shown \u200dinterest in running on \u200dNo Labels, a <a href=\"https:\/\/www.conservativenewsdaily.net\/breaking-news\/joe-manchin-about-to-exact-revenge-on-dems-third-party-presidential-run-could-be-imminent\/\" title=\"Is Joe Manchin Planning a Third-Party Presidential Run as Revenge Against Dems?\">centrist group exploring<\/a> an independent bid. However, Biden&#8217;s allies have raised concerns about the potential of such a candidate drawing Democratic or independent voters\u200d away from the\u200c president.<\/p>\n<blockquote>\n<p>&#8220;It would have \u2064to be a Joe Biden-Donald\u2062 Trump rematch \u200cthat shows Joe Biden is almost certain to lose,&#8221; \u200cPhillips told the New York Times. &#8220;That is the only condition in which I would even entertain a conversation with any alternative.&#8221;<\/p>\n<\/blockquote>\n<p>Phillips has a \u200clongstanding relationship with Nancy\u200d Jacobson, the chief executive of No Labels, from\u200c his\u200c time in\u200d the\u200c group&#8217;s \u2062congressional Problem Solvers Caucus.<\/p>\n<blockquote>\n<p>&#8220;People are\u200d criticizing them because\u2064 they \u200dbelieve whomever they offer on their ticket will \u2063hurt\u2063 Joe Biden,&#8221; he said. &#8220;That&#8217;s false. If they put someone at the top of the ticket who could actually drive votes from Donald Trump, every Democrat in the United States of America\u2062 should be celebrating it. They haven&#8217;t made that determination.&#8221;<\/p>\n<\/blockquote>\n<p>Phillips has \u2064been focusing his campaign efforts in New Hampshire,\u2064 where Biden will not appear on the ballot due to changes in the primary schedule. Despite the Democratic \u2064National Committee&#8217;s decision to move South Carolina to the first-in-the-nation position, New Hampshire maintained its primary schedule,\u2063 prompting Biden&#8217;s campaign not to file in the state.<\/p>\n<p>However,\u200d there is a group in New Hampshire working on\u2062 a Biden write-in effort \u2064to\u200d ensure his victory.<\/p>\n<p>Phillips&#8217; campaign has taken \u200cadvantage of Biden&#8217;s \u2063absence in\u2062 the \u2064state and aims to challenge him on Jan. 23.
